The Collection Process
Step 1: Submit the Account
You send us the basic claim information: debtor name, contact details, amount owed, and any documentation you have (invoices, contracts, correspondence). No complex intake forms. Most clients are up and running within 24 hours.
Step 2: Initial Contact and Demand
Our team reaches the debtor by phone, letter, and email. We identify ourselves as a licensed third-party collection agency working on your behalf. Commercial (B2B) claims between businesses fall outside the Fair Debt Collection Practices Act (FDCPA) That law governs consumer debt. We hold our commercial work to the same professional standard. Commercial claims are handled with direct, professional demand language. We don’t threaten. We make the cost of non-payment clear.
Step 3: Negotiation and Resolution
Many accounts settle at this stage. Debtors who ignored your calls often respond when a professional agency enters the picture. We negotiate payment in full or structured arrangements depending on the situation. Every resolution is cleared with you before we accept it.
Step 4: Escalation (When Needed)
If initial demand doesn’t move the account, we escalate. That can mean skip tracing to locate updated contact information, more frequent outreach, and referral to one of our network attorneys for legal action. All still on contingency unless litigation fees apply.
Step 5: Recovery and Reporting
When funds are collected, you receive your share minus our contingency fee. You also get reporting throughout the process so you’re never in the dark about account status.

Why a Collection Agency Beats DIY for Small Businesses
Most small business owners try to collect in-house first. That’s the right call for 30-day-old invoices. But past 90 days, in-house collection has three problems:
Time. Your staff time is worth more than the average disputed invoice. Every hour chasing a bad debt is an hour not spent on sales, operations, or client work.
Leverage. Debtors know you. They know how persistent you’ll actually be. A licensed third-party agency is a different signal entirely. When we call, the dynamic changes.
Expertise. FDCPA compliance, skip tracing, attorney referral networks, credit bureau reporting. These are infrastructure investments that don’t make sense for one or two accounts a year. We’ve built that infrastructure since 2004. You use it on contingency. That’s what commercial collections infrastructure looks like applied to small business accounts.
There’s also the creditor reputation effect. When you consistently refer past-due accounts to a collection agency, word spreads that you enforce your terms. That changes how clients treat your invoices.

Commercial debt collection (business-to-business claims) operates under different rules than consumer collection. There is no 30-day validation notice requirement, no CFPB Reg F dispute window, no mini-Miranda on B2B calls. But we still follow professional standards on every account: no harassment, no misrepresentation, no contact at unreasonable hours.
If you’re a small business and you’re not sure whether your claim is commercial or consumer, tell us when you submit. We’ll route it correctly.
